Resident Evil Showcase Confirmed For January 15 With New Resident Evil Requiem Details

Capcom has announced that it will host its Resident Evil Showcase on January 15, 2026 at 2.00pm PST, where fans will get new details on the upcoming Resident Evil Requiem.

The showcase will last around 12 minutes, and a teaser video can be seen below which offers a brief glimpse at gameplay featuring Grace and Leon. Speaking of the former Raccoon Police cop, it’s probably a safe bet to assume we will be getting some new footage of Leon’s part in the story and how he will play in comparison to Grace, as Capcom only confirmed he’ll be appearing in Requiem last month.

Resident Evil Requiem is slated for release on February 27, 2026 for PS5, PC, Nintendo Switch 2, and Xbox Series X/S. The game takes place around 30 years after the destruction of Raccoon City (as depicted at the end of Resident Evil 3: Nemesis), and sees Grace Ashcroft investigating a series of murders in a hotel; the same location her mother, Alyssa, was brutally killed some years before. Meanwhile, Leon has been dispatched to the Midwest to look into a number of incidents linked an ex-Umbrella scientist.
